Interest at one view, calculated to a farthing : At 2 1/2, 3,3 1/2, 4,5,6,7, and 8 per cent. For 1000 Đ. to 1 Đ. for 1 day to 96 days; and for 1,2,3,4,5,6,7,8,9,10,11, and 12 months. With rules and examples to cast up interest at any rate, by the said tables. With a curious table, whereby standard gold and silver, in bars, is compared with the courses of exchange between Amsterdam and London. Also tables for reducing the most common gold coins to pounds, and the contarary: being very useful in receiving and paying monies. The eighth edition, with additions. Carefully calculated and examined from the press, by Richard Hayes. To which is added, a concise table, whereby to cast up salaries and wages speedily, and others of great use in receiving and paying of money.
